Pay day loans and Bankruptcy

Payday advances are believed debt that is unsecured. Generally, whether you file under Chapter 7 or Chapter 13, credit card debt is dischargeable in bankruptcy. That’s great news for you. Needless to say, payday loan providers aren’t likely to throw in the towel therefore effortlessly. They’ll item to your release, claiming it back that you took out the loan without any intention of paying. In the event that you took down a quick payday loan immediately before filing for bankruptcy, they could have an instance in court.

Strategies for Discharging The Debt

To be sure your payday advances are released during your bankruptcy, don’t file soon after having a cash advance. The bankruptcy trustee will require a look that is careful loans and acquisitions inside the 70 to ninety days prior to filing for bankruptcy. The court would like to verify you’re perhaps not taking right out loans or making big acquisitions without any intention of repayment and then making use of bankruptcy as a means to leave from underneath the financial obligation. Wait at the least 90 days when you have a loan that is payday filing for bankruptcy.

Happily, courts generally disfavor payday loan providers. In some instances, courts will think about the start date of the cash advance to function as day you took away very first pay day loan from that loan provider, as opposed to your most current one. That will push you straight straight right back beyond the 90-day limit. Even though the court chooses that your particular loan falls in the window that is 90-day the payday lender will need to demonstrate that you took out of the loan with fraudulent intent. It’s a case that is tough them to show in addition to court is biased on your side.

Watch out for Post-Dated Checks, Lending Fraud

In the event that you left your payday loan provider a postdated check, they might nevertheless make an effort to cash that check when you’ve filed for bankruptcy. Generally, that is considered a breach associated with the stay that is automatic the financial institution could be prone to you for damages. Nevertheless, the litigation procedure usually takes more money and time than bankruptcy filers have actually. In the event that you provided your lender a post-dated check and later filed for bankruptcy, notify you lawyer, your bank, as well as your bankruptcy trustee immediately. According to the costs your bank charges in addition to wide range of post-dated checks you’ve got outstanding, you could simply want to spend the stop-payment charge regarding the checks and steer clear of the matter from arising after all.

Payday loan providers will frequently express to borrowers that a post-dated be sure does not undergo is similar as composing a negative check, which can be an offense that is criminal. That just is not true — it is only a scare strategy. You can cancel the check before the lender cashes it if you file for bankruptcy. In the event that loan provider has recently cashed it, you can easily need the return for the cash to your bankruptcy property. You don’t need certainly to be concerned about any repercussions that are criminal.
